The YONEX Nanoray Light 18i Badminton Racquet is a solid choice for players looking for speed and control on the court. Weighing in at just 77 grams, this ultra-light racquet enhances maneuverability, allowing for quick reactions and swift shots. It features NANOSCIENCE technology, which helps deliver powerful shots with a stiff flex, making it suitable for players who enjoy aggressive playstyles. The isometric head shape provides a larger sweet spot, which is a great advantage for beginners and intermediate players alike, as it increases the chances of hitting the shuttlecock effectively.

The 30 lbs string tension may not suit everyone, especially if you prefer a softer feel when hitting. This higher tension is better for advanced players who can handle the extra stiffness and demand more power and control. Additionally, the grip size (G4) may not fit everyone comfortably, so potential buyers should consider whether this size works for their hand.

The balance is head-light, which aids in quick maneuvering but may sacrifice some power in smashes; players focused on control and precision will likely appreciate this design choice. The racquet is versatile enough for all skill levels, making it an appealing option for recreational players and those looking to improve. With a strong construction made of carbon graphite, durability is also a strong point for this model. However, it might not be the best pick for those who prioritize heavy-weight rackets for more power-driven strokes. The YONEX Nanoray Light 18i is a balanced option for players seeking speed, control, and a lightweight feel.

The YONEX Astrox Lite 27i is a great choice for intermediate badminton players looking for a lightweight and powerful racket. Weighing just 77 grams, it offers impressive maneuverability and speed, thanks to its slim shaft design. This makes it easier to generate power while maintaining control. The ISOMETRIC frame enhances the sweet spot, which can help players achieve better accuracy without sacrificing power - perfect for those looking to improve their game. The combination of a graphite frame and shaft adds to the durability and responsiveness of the racket.

Another notable feature is the AERO+BOX frame, which balances solid hitting feelings with quick swings, making it easier to transition between shots. The Control Support CAP provides a wider grip area, enhancing handling and follow-through, which can be especially beneficial for players focusing on precision. Furthermore, the Rotational Generator System distributes weight throughout the racket, aiding in swift movements and control during rallies.

This racket shines in many areas, although it may not fully meet the needs of advanced players who might require more customized options, such as different grip sizes or higher string tensions for more advanced techniques. The maximum string tension of 30lbs is suitable for most intermediate players, but potentially limiting for those who prefer tighter strings for enhanced performance.

Buying Guide for the Best Yonex Badminton Rackets

Choosing the right badminton racket can significantly impact your game. The right racket should complement your playing style, skill level, and physical attributes. When selecting a Yonex badminton racket, consider the following key specifications to ensure you get the best fit for your needs.
WeightThe weight of a badminton racket is crucial as it affects your swing speed and control. Rackets are typically categorized into 2U (90-94g), 3U (85-89g), 4U (80-84g), and 5U (75-79g). Heavier rackets (2U, 3U) provide more power and stability, making them suitable for players with strong wrists and arms. Lighter rackets (4U, 5U) offer better maneuverability and are ideal for defensive players or those who prefer quick, fast-paced games. Choose a weight that matches your strength and playing style.
Balance PointThe balance point of a racket determines its distribution of weight and can be head-heavy, even-balanced, or head-light. Head-heavy rackets provide more power and are suitable for aggressive players who rely on smashing. Even-balanced rackets offer a mix of power and control, making them versatile for all-round play. Head-light rackets are easier to maneuver and are preferred by defensive players or those who play a lot of net shots. Select a balance point that aligns with your playing style and strategy.
FlexibilityRacket flexibility refers to how much the shaft bends during play. It can be categorized as stiff, medium, or flexible. Stiff rackets offer more control and are suitable for advanced players with fast, powerful swings. Medium flexibility provides a balance of power and control, making it ideal for intermediate players. Flexible rackets generate more power with less effort, which is beneficial for beginners or players with slower swing speeds. Choose a flexibility level that matches your skill level and swing speed.
Grip SizeGrip size affects how comfortably you can hold and control the racket. Yonex rackets typically come in sizes G1 to G5, with G1 being the largest and G5 the smallest. A larger grip provides more stability and is suitable for players with larger hands or those who prefer a firmer hold. A smaller grip allows for more wrist action and is ideal for players with smaller hands or those who rely on quick, precise shots. Select a grip size that feels comfortable in your hand and allows you to play without strain.
String TensionString tension impacts the racket's power and control. Higher tension (24-30 lbs) offers more control and is preferred by advanced players who can generate their own power. Lower tension (18-23 lbs) provides more power and a larger sweet spot, making it suitable for beginners and intermediate players. Choose a string tension that complements your skill level and playing style. Remember that higher tension requires more precise hits, while lower tension is more forgiving.
